About Alireza Beiranvand
Alireza Beiranvand is a goalkeeper in Amir Ghalenoei's confirmed 26-man Iran squad for the 2026 World Cup, going to the finals at 33. A long-time Iran number one, he is a multiple Persian Gulf Pro League champion with Persepolis and was the 2018-19 Iranian Player of the Year.
The draw places Iran in Group G alongside Belgium, Egypt and New Zealand, and they qualified for the finals by winning their AFC third-round group in March 2025. Beiranvand is among Ghalenoei's goalkeeping options for the group stage.

Playing Style
A tall, commanding goalkeeper at 1.95 m, Beiranvand is known for his shot-stopping and penalty saving and for an exceptionally long throw that launches counter-attacks. He is right-footed.
This season he has kept goal for 1,710 club minutes for Tractor, going into the group stage in Amir Ghalenoei's squad at 33.

World Cup History
The 2026 World Cup will be Alireza Beiranvand's third at senior level, after he started in goal at the 2018 and 2022 finals. In 2018 he saved a Cristiano Ronaldo penalty in the 1-1 draw with Portugal. His international career runs to 86 caps for Iran.
